Maple Floor Staining in Olathe, KS
Maple floor staining services involve applying specialized stains to enhance the appearance of existing maple flooring or to change its color for aesthetic purposes. This process is commonly requested for residential projects such as updating a room’s look, restoring worn or faded floors, or achieving a specific design style. Homeowners should consider factors like the current condition of the wood, the desired color or finish, and how the stain will complement other interior elements before requesting this service. Proper preparation and selection of stain types are essential to ensure a smooth, even finish that enhances the natural beauty of maple flooring.
Property owners often seek maple floor staining to achieve a consistent color tone across multiple rooms or to highlight the wood’s grain pattern. It’s important to understand the different stain options available, including shades and transparency levels, to match personal preferences and existing decor. Additionally, questions about the maintenance and durability of stained maple floors are common, as homeowners want to ensure the finish will hold up over time. Clarifying these details beforehand can help in making informed decisions about the best staining approach for a specific project.
